Overview
This chapter gives an overview of the 512-Mbit Double-Data-Rate-Two SDRAM product family and describes its main
characteristics.
1.1
Features
The 512-Mbit Double-Data-Rate-Two SDRAM offers the following key features:

1) RoHS Compliant Product: Restriction of the use of certain hazardous substances (RoHS) in electrical and electronic equipment as defined
in the directive 2002/95/EC issued by the European Parliament and of the Council of 27 January 2003. These substances include mercury,
lead, cadmium, hexavalent chromium, polybrominated biphenyls and polybrominated biphenyl ethers.
